Knollwood Investment Trust

Knollwood Investment Trust (7520 Oxford Garden Cir, Apollo Beach, FL 33572) from the Financial Planning Services Directory

Knollwood Investment Trust

Address:
7520 Oxford Garden Cir
Apollo Beach, FL 33572

Phone:
(813) 720-7355

See Also: Florida Financial Planning Services

Map

About

This is a business listing for Knollwood Investment Trust (7520 Oxford Garden Cir, Apollo Beach, FL 33572) from the Financial Planning Services directory, under Florida Financial Planning Services, provided by moneycontrol.me.

Frequently Asked Questions About Knollwood Investment Trust

Where is Knollwood Investment Trust located?

Knollwood Investment Trust is located at: 7520 Oxford Garden Cir, Apollo Beach, FL 33572.

What is Knollwood Investment Trust's phone number?

Knollwood Investment Trust's phone number is: (813) 720-7355.

Other Listings

You can find more similar services in Florida Financial Planning Services from our Financial Planning Services Directory.

Here are some other listings in the Apollo Beach, FL Financial Planning Services Directory: Ronald Goldberg.